Recent Innovations and Projects

The realm of hobby electronics is undergoing remarkable transformations, driven by a variety of recent innovations and projects that encapsulate creativity and technical mastery. Among the most notable advancements are improvements in components such as sensors, microcontrollers, and Internet of Things (IoT) technologies. These innovations are making hobbyist projects more accessible and sophisticated, leading to a surge in DIY creativity.

Microcontrollers like the popular Arduino and Raspberry Pi have remained the backbone of hobby electronics enthusiasts. They allow users to build diverse projects ranging from simple LED displays to complex home automation systems. Recent iterations of these platforms have introduced enhanced features, offering greater processing power, improved connectivity options, and better compatibility with various sensors and peripherals. This enables hobbyists to create intricate and functional designs that would have previously required a higher skill level.

The rise of advanced sensors plays a crucial role in the current hobby electronics landscape. Innovative sensors that detect temperature, humidity, motion, and light are widely available, enabling hobbyists to incorporate real-world data into their projects easily. For instance, combining a light sensor with an Arduino can produce automatic lighting systems that enhance energy efficiency in homes.

Additionally, online platforms and forums have become instrumental in disseminating knowledge and project tutorials. Communities on websites like Instructables, Hackster.io, and various social media groups frequently share project builds, encouraging beginners and seasoned enthusiasts alike to explore new ideas. Examples of trending projects include smart garden systems, automated pet feeders, and home security setups, all leveraging the capabilities of contemporary microcontrollers and sensors.

Resources for Hobbyists

For enthusiasts in the field of hobby electronics, the internet has become an invaluable repository of knowledge, fostering both learning and collaboration. Various websites cater to different skill levels, providing a wealth of information ranging from beginner tutorials to advanced project ideas. Notably, websites like Instructables and Adafruit serve as excellent starting points for those new to the hobby, offering step-by-step guides that simplify complex concepts. For more seasoned hobbyists, platforms like Hackaday and Electronics Weekly present a treasure trove of innovative projects and cutting-edge developments, allowing users to push their limits and explore advanced techniques.

Community forums also play a crucial role in the growth of hobby electronics. Websites such as the EEVblog Forum and All About Circuits offer spaces for hobbyists to troubleshoot and share their experiences. These interactive forums encourage dialogue and facilitate the exchange of ideas, ensuring that users can receive feedback and support in real time. For quick tips and solutions, Reddit has become a popular destination, especially subreddits like r/FPGA or r/Electronics, where users can find concise information and assistance.

In addition to these resources, YouTube stands out as a powerful medium for hobbyists. Channels like GreatScott!, EEVblog, and Mikey Chow feature engaging video content that demonstrates projects and safety practices, making it easier for visual learners to grasp technical concepts. Furthermore, open-source hardware has revolutionized the field of hobby electronics. Platforms like Arduino and Raspberry Pi not only provide affordable hardware solutions but also encourage the sharing of open-source software, fostering an expansive community of creators.
